Training That Centers on Kids

Pediatric dentists study longer than general dentists. After regular dental school, they learn how to treat baby teeth, watch for developmental issues, and handle childhood habits like thumb-sucking.

Thanks to this extra training, we can offer the right treatments at the right times.

Why Start Dental Visits Early?

You may have heard that children should see a dentist by their first birthday—or within six months of their first tooth appearing.

That might feel early, but these visits get your child used to the office and can catch small problems before they turn into bigger ones.

1. When Should My Child Start Brushing?

Begin brushing as soon as that first tooth appears! Use a soft toothbrush with a tiny amount of fluoride toothpaste—about the size of a grain of rice. These habits help set the stage for strong, healthy teeth. We’ll share more tips when you visit Shine Pediatric Dentistry & Orthodontics.

2. Should My Child Get an Orthodontic Checkup?

An early orthodontic check can find problems with your child’s bite or jaw growth. We often suggest a check by age seven. If we spot any issues, we’ll talk about next steps.

3. Are Baby Teeth Really That Important?

Yes! Baby teeth hold space for the adult teeth waiting underneath. They’re also vital for chewing and speaking. Taking good care of baby teeth now means fewer problems as your child’s smile changes.
